When the pirates got a clear look at Ren Arakawa's face, they were first stunned, then their faces flushed red with excitement, like a pack of starving wild wolves that had spotted a lone, fat sheep.

The pirates didn't usually attend classes.

One of the few things they bothered to memorize was wanted posters.

This was to avoid running into a master they couldn't recognize and suffering for it.

At this moment, even if some of them didn't recognize Ren Arakawa, they were quickly reminded by their fellow pirates who he was—the genius pirate who had just recently become "famous."

"Hahahaha, isn't that the 14-year-old kid with the 300 million Beri bounty, the one whose history is a complete blank—Ren!"

A pirate yelled at the top of his lungs, "Taking down Ace might be some trouble, but taking care of this kid? That'll be as easy as bedding my own wife! Get him!"

With that, they unhesitatingly split off about half of their number and charged toward Ren Arakawa.

"Mentally unstable," Ren Arakawa commented on the crazed pirates.

The pirate in the lead had a face full of savage flesh and tightly gripped a giant wolf-fang club. He raised it high, the spikes on the club glinting coldly in the light. He widened his bloodshot eyes, as if he was about to smash Ren Arakawa into a meat paste in the next second.

However, facing this surging tide of people, Ren Arakawa's expression remained unchanged, his demeanor chillingly calm, without a trace of fear.

Was this a joke? Who were the people he had faced before?

Sasori of the Red Sand, Akatsuki's Big Dipper, Magellan, Shiryu of the Rain...

And this bunch of small fry?

He couldn't even be bothered to form Hand Seals.

Just as the pirates were about to reach him, Ren Arakawa took a deep breath. The aura around him suddenly erupted, and immediately after, a layer of black light as deep as the night sky spread rapidly from his feet to the top of his head, like a living entity. In the blink of an eye, it had completely covered his entire body.

The black light wasn't static; it flowed and churned slowly like boiling black magma, exuding a chilling sense of pressure—it was precisely Armament Haki, and a powerful Armament Haki at that, cultivated to Tier one and capable of perfectly coating his entire body!

This scene struck the charging pirates like a bolt of lightning. Their forward momentum came to an abrupt halt, and the excitement and greed on their faces were instantly replaced by shock.

They looked at each other, their eyes filled with terror and regret, a single thought echoing in their minds: Crap! We underestimated him!

In this world overrun by pirates, a bounty was an important measure of a pirate's strength.

The pirates knew well that if someone obtained a high bounty solely through their Devil Fruit ability, there was still an element of luck involved, or it was due to the powerful properties of the Devil Fruit itself. Such a pirate might have a weakness that could be exploited.

But Ren Arakawa, before them now, held a 300 million bounty at such a young age, yet what he displayed was not reliance on a Devil Fruit, but this solid, intermediate-Tier Armament Haki forged through countless life-and-death struggles.

What did this mean? It meant he was undoubtedly a ruthless character who had clawed his way up from brutal battles since childhood, fighting through bloodbaths all the way! Every bit of his strength was built from sweat and pain, without the slightest bit of fluff. How could he be so easily shaken by people like them, who relied on luck and hoped to get an easy score?

After a brief moment of shock, the pirates began to have second thoughts. Some were already considering turning back to attack Ace instead.

Ren Arakawa had no patience to let these pirates continue their nonsense. In the instant the stalemate continued, a cold light flashed in his eyes, and he pushed off violently from the ground!

With a *whoosh*, his entire body vanished from the spot like a flash of lightning.

This was "Soru" from the Six Powers!

In the blink of an eye, Ren Arakawa appeared among the pirates like a ghost. He held a strange, twenty-centimeter-long feather in his hand. Wisps of Armament Haki, as deep as ink, coiled and flowed around the feather.

His figure was like lightning, weaving through the pirates. Every time he waved the feather, it left a black afterimage. The seemingly light and fluttering movements were accompanied by numerous miserable cries.

*Pfft—* *Pfft—* A series of horrifying, muffled sounds rang out. Wherever the feather passed, blood-filled holes were instantly torn open on the chests, arms, and backs of the pirates. Fresh blood gushed out like a fountain.

These pirates stared with terrified eyes. Before they could even scream, they had already collapsed to the ground, twitching in agony.

By coordinating his Three-Tomoe Sharingan with his own Observation Haki, Ren Arakawa was like someone with eyes in the back of his head. He predicted every danger in advance, dodging the pirates' frantic counterattacks by a hair's breadth every time, toying with them until they were completely powerless to fight back.

On the other side, Ace had also completely taken control of the battlefield.

His entire body was wreathed in flames as he pushed the powerful abilities of the Flame-Flame Fruit to their limit.

As he waved his hands, massive waves of fire roared out, sweeping toward the surrounding pirates in a fan shape. Wherever they went, tables, chairs, and benches were instantly turned to ash. The pirates were burned until they screamed like ghosts and howled like wolves, scattering in all directions, their formation utterly broken.

But such a large-scale attack, though impressive, was extremely taxing, and its efficiency in clearing enemies was far inferior to Ren Arakawa's.

Ren Arakawa was like a whirlwind sweeping through fallen leaves, swiftly reaping the enemies among the group of pirates. His movements were too fast to be seen clearly, and his efficiency was astonishingly high.

Before long, the pirates around him were lying on the ground in disarray, having lost their ability to resist.

Ren Arakawa spun around and landed steadily to the side. His icy gaze swept over the few remaining pirates who were still putting up a futile resistance. An immense pressure radiated from him, like tangible ropes, tightening around the necks of these pirates.

"Hand over your money!" Ren Arakawa's voice was low, but it echoed in everyone's ears like a great bell, leaving no room for doubt.

The pirates were so scared their legs went soft. They tremblingly pulled out their Beri from their pockets and threw them on the ground, their faces full of pleading.

"You're just going to throw it on the ground for me!?"

A red dot appeared in Ren Arakawa's eyes! A terrifying Conqueror's Haki leaked out just slightly, and it was more than these pirates could handle. Their eyes held the terror of a man about to watch his entire clan be annihilated. They hurriedly scrambled to pick up the Beri from the ground, half-kneeling as they held it up to Ren Arakawa.

By now, Ace had just stopped his attacks, panting heavily with his hands on his knees.

He looked at the wreckage all over the floor, then at the calm and composed Ren Arakawa, who was taking money from the fallen pirates one by one. His eyes were filled with shock and admiration.

Although the pirates hadn't managed to land a single hit on Ace, the fight had still left him panting.

Ace said, "You... you're so strong. Thank you for your help."

"No need for thanks," Ren Arakawa said, his expression unchanged. "What they gave was the price for their own lives. You have to pay a protection fee too. If you object, you don't have to pay."

Ace suddenly burst into a wide grin. "I never thought I'd be the one getting... protected. Alright then! Come to my ship, I'll get it for you."
